Understanding ADHD Assessment Tests for Adults
Attention Deficit Hyperactivity Disorder (ADHD) is typically associated with children, but it affects many adults too. In fact, adult ADHD is a recognized condition that can significantly affect numerous elements of life, consisting of work, relationships, and self-esteem. What is ADHD?
ADHD is a neurodevelopmental disorder defined by relentless patterns of negligence, hyperactivity, and impulsivity. Symptoms can vary commonly from one individual to another, making a medical diagnosis necessary. For adults, symptoms might consist of:
- Difficulty organizing jobs
- Chronic procrastination
- Impulsiveness in decision-making
- Difficulty keeping focus in discussions
- Frequent state of mind swings
Comprehending these symptoms is necessary when seeking an assessment, as specialists use various tests and questionnaires to assess a person's experiences.

Typical Assessment Methods
ADHD evaluations for adults usually consist of a mix of self-report questionnaires, interviews, and behavioral assessments. The following table sums up the common assessment methods:
| Method | Description | Function |
|---|---|---|
| Self-Report Questionnaires | Standardized questionnaires that evaluate symptoms based on the individual's point of views. Examples include the Adult ADHD Self-Report Scale (ASRS) and the Conners Adult ADHD Rating Scale. | To collect initial data on symptoms and their severity. |
| Scientific Interviews | A structured or semi-structured interview carried out by a healthcare professional to gather detailed background information. | To understand the person's life history and sign development. |
| Behavioral Assessments | Observations of behavior in specific settings, such as throughout work or in social circumstances. | To evaluate how symptoms manifest in real-life contexts. |
| Neuropsychological Testing | Involves cognitive tests to evaluate executive functions, attention, memory, and psychological regulation. | To rule out other conditions and provide a detailed assessment. |
The Assessment Process
The assessment procedure for adult ADHD is comprehensive and can be broken down into a number of stages:
Initial Consultation:Individuals looking for an assessment will first seek advice from a doctor. During this consultation, the company will talk about symptoms, medical history, and any other pertinent details.
Questionnaires:After the preliminary assessment, individuals may be asked to finish self-report questionnaires highlighting specific symptoms and behaviors. These standardized tests provide important insight into the intensity and variety of symptoms experienced.
Medical Interview:A more comprehensive clinical interview might follow. This aspect of the assessment assists the critic gather in-depth information about the person's history and present performance.
Behavioral Observations:If necessary, psychologists might conduct observations in real-life settings to supply insight into how symptoms manifest.
Neuropsychological Testing:In some cases, people might undergo cognitive testing to assess their attention and executive performance.
Feedback and Diagnosis:After completing assessments, the company will examine all info gathered, make a diagnosis (if appropriate), and discuss treatment choices.
Regularly Asked Questions
1. For how long does an ADHD assessment take?
ADHD assessments can vary in length depending upon the approaches utilized. Normally, the process might take several hours, including time for completing surveys, interviews, and potential testing.
2. Who can conduct an ADHD assessment?
ADHD assessments can be conducted by numerous experts, consisting of psychologists, psychiatrists, and skilled therapists with experience in adult ADHD.
3. Is there a specific age for ADHD medical diagnosis in adults?
While ADHD is typically identified in childhood, symptoms can continue into the adult years. As such, adults of any age can be assessed and detected with ADHD.

5. What are the treatment options after diagnosis?
Treatment alternatives can include therapy (such as cognitive-behavioral therapy), medication (like stimulants or non-stimulants), lifestyle changes, and support system.
